  1. Introduction to the Common Statistical Production ArchitectureAlice Kovarikova High-Level Workshop on Modernization of Official Statistics, Nizhny Novgorod, 10- 12 June 2014

  2. The problem • 2 big barriers that hamper modernisation of statistical organisations are: • Rigid processes and methods • Inflexible and ageing technology environment

  3. Problem statement: Specialised business processes, methods and IT systems for each survey / output

  10. CSPA development project Architecture Proof of Concept

  11. Editrules G Code The Proof of Concept • 5 countries played the role of Builders • 3 countries played the role of Assemblers CANCEIS SCS Blaise

  12. What did we prove?

  13. CSPA is practical and can be implemented by various agencies in a consistent way

  14. You can fit CSPA Statistical Services into existing processes Statistics New Zealand (Workflow) Istat (CORE)

  15. CSPA does not depend on a specific technology platform Statistics New Zealand (Workflow) Istat (CORE)

  16. You can swap out CSPA compliant services easily Statistics New Zealand (Workflow)

  17. Reusing the same statistical service by configuration Survey A Survey B Statistics Sweden (Workflow -Triton)

  18. 2013 – CSPA Development 2014 – CSPA Implementation

  19. Services being built • Seasonal Adjustment – France,Australia, New Zealand • Confidentiality on the fly – Canada, Australia • Error correction – Italy • SVG Generator – OECD • SDMX transform – OECD • Selecting sample from business register – Netherlands • Editing components – Netherlands • Classification Editor – Norway

  20. Architecture Working Group:Australia, Austria, Canada, France, Italy, Mexico, Netherlands, New Zealand, Turkey, United Kingdom, Eurostat • Catalogue team:Australia, Canada, Italy, Hungary, New Zealand, Romania, Turkey, Eurostat
